The Event Approval process will allow administrators to review and approve newly created events. All groups using an event approvals process will go through a three-step process

  • Step 1 - Event Creation: User inputs event information

  • Step 2 - Supplemental Event Information: User clicks Saves and submits a supplemental form that is customized by Admins to ask the additional questions about the event

  • Step 3 - Event Approval: Event is approved with either a Simple Approval or a Workflow Approval

We recommend using a Workflow approval

 

Follow these steps to set up an Event Approval Process:

  1. Click on Admin

  2. Click on the Settings dropdown and select Approval Processes

  3. After clicking Create Process, select Event Approval

  4. Here, you will select all the specifications to build out this event approval process. You’ll be able to do the following:

    • Select the Group Types to which this approval process will apply

    • Choose Yes to activate the Event Approval

    • Select the supplemental Form/Survey that should be tied to the Event Approval Process

      • While all approval processes must be tied to a supplemental form, you can leave this blank for now if you have not yet created your form

    • Include verbiage for an Event Confirmation message that will appear at the top of your supplemental form

    • Set if you would like to Automatically approve recurring events when the parent event is approved

      • When set to Yes, green-lighting the initial event extends approval to all recurring events

      • When set to No, each recurring event needs separate approval

      • We recommend opting for Yes to expedite approval process

    • Decide if you want to Reset approval on any change made to the event

      • Selecting Yes triggers approval reset upon any modification by the officer

      • Selecting No limits reset to just event dates/times, description, location, and name, however, this can be customized

      • We recommendation opting for No to maintain approval consistency unless necessary changes occur

  1. Once the Supplemental Form is connected to the Approval Process, be sure to connect a Workflow to the Supplemental Form if you are using a multi-step approval process
